Job Summary
The Senior Manager, Signals and Communication – Standards and Help Desk is responsible for overseeing the standards of all regions including documentation and expiration of testing and installation processes. The role is accountable for overseeing and handling the advanced monitoring systems and operational efficiency of the system call desks. The incumbent leads the department responsible for governing all Signals and Communications (S&C) maintenance, installation for the field, back office, General Instructions (GI), and federal testing at set intervals. The role requires following codes of practices and reviews of documentation to ensure CN’s full compliance in the United States (U.S.) and Canada.
Main Responsibilities
S&C Standards
- Oversee priority items and provide vision and guidance for the task
- Execute final approval of work completed before it is communicated to the Chief Engineer
- Connect with related CN stakeholders to efficiently remove roadblocks and understand certain action items
- Work with Information and Technology (I&T) for changes to or issues in Signals and Communications Inspection System (SCIS)
- Handle S&C costs related to material, quality, and processes by collaborating with vendors
- Handle all changes required in engineering technologies enhancements
- Secure funding from special capital portfolio for S&C, resolve budget allocation, and forecasting for vendors to provide equipment delivery on time for high-level projects
- Ensure all documentation and installation practices are created in compliance under Transport Canada (TC) and Federal Railway Association (FRA) regulations

Working Conditions
The role is performed in a combination of office and outdoor environments with various conditions with a regular workweek from Monday to Friday. The role requires travel (up to 35%) in Canada and U.S. Due to the nature of the role, the incumbent must be able to meet tight deadlines, handle pressure, and stress.

About CN
CN is a world-class transportation leader and trade-enabler. Essential to the economy, to the customers, and to the communities it serves, CN safely transports more than 300 million tons of natural resources, manufactured products, and finished goods throughout North America every year. As the only railroad connecting Canada’s Eastern and Western coasts with the Southern tip of the U.S. through a 19,500 mile rail network, CN and its affiliates have been contributing to community prosperity and sustainable trade since 1919. CN is committed to programs supporting social responsibility and environmental stewardship.
